Stereo downmix EVS - Bad mode selection based on ITD.
Basic info
Bug description
There is an ITD mismatch between fixed and floating-point codes of stereo downmix, which results in ‘wrong’ decision between POC and PHA modes.
This issue is illustrated by an Orange file (voice_music.wav) already shared with NTT.
- ITD for floating-point (top) and for fixed-point (bottom) :
- Output signals for floating-point (top) and for fixed-point (bottom) :
Ways to reproduce
./IVAS_cod -stereo_dmx_evs 128000 48 voice_music.wav bit
./IVAS_dec 48 bit voice_music_128000_48-48.wav
Edited by lefort